A wine stop in East Texas can feel very different from a Fredericksburg itinerary.
Properties are farther apart, the local agricultural backdrop is distinct, and the most memorable visits often come from slowing down and talking with the people behind the wines. If the schedule is limited or the property is event-driven, calling ahead can save a long detour. Rather than trying to taste everything, give the visit enough time to understand the producer. A few well-chosen pours, a conversation about grape sourcing and a sense of how this location fits the broader winery story will tell you more than a rushed flight. That is especially true in Texas, where the vineyard, production space and tasting room are not always in the same place.
